ORIGINAL: AdderMk2

ORIGINAL: 2 kwik

10.5" slick26" tall
WITH the quads??? i dont think so
yup, you just reverse them end for end, and you can still get a finger in there. they might rub in a hard hard corner, but you shouldn't be cornering that hard on slicks anyways (and mine don't even if i do) but they might.

radial size is 255/50/16 i believe ? here are mine on my '93 and the car is lowered too.
